Anti-money laundering (AML) monitoring devices are considered a crucial component of regulatory compliance in the online gambling industry. They detect suspicious activity and signal potential risks, ensuring operators remain vigilant and maintaining a safe gaming environment. By detecting actual activity and analyzing transactions, these devices help protect the industry from money laundering and other financial crimes. They also provide benefits such as effective risk management and improved customer service.

Anti-money laundering (AML) tools utilize leading technologies such as customer data analysis and transaction history, enabling them to detect malicious activity within the context of actual transactions (SEON). These responses are based on artificial intelligence, automated training methods, and predictive analysis, improving the reliability of detection and risk analysis. They also reduce the incidence of false positives, allowing casino operators to focus their efforts on investigating real threats.

In Europe, interactive casino regulation is carried out by national regulators such as the UKGC and MGA, which issue licenses, implement KYC and AML requirements, and conduct financial audits. These institutions are also the headquarters of the pan-European organization for data protection, financial security, and responsible gaming. They collaborate with EU-level groups such as EGBA and GREF on data exchange regarding licensing, the harmonization of responsible gaming devices, and the development of training programs in accordance with international standards.

As online gambling gains popularity, regulators are stepping up enforcement outside of casinos. They're implementing more stringent anti-money laundering (AML) regulations and risk assessments with know-your-customer (KYC) requirements. They also require detailed background checks and transaction forecasts. This includes detecting unsavory bet modifications, even chip resets, and structured transactions that violate reporting thresholds. Furthermore, regulated casinos are required to monitor cryptocurrency transactions to ensure they aren't used for money laundering or by criminals or criminals facing penalties.
